Overview

Revit MCP is a Python package that provides integration with Revit through the Model Context Protocol (MCP). It allows you to send commands to Revit and receive responses, enabling automation and interaction with Revit models.

Features

  • Connect to Revit addon socket server.
  • Send commands to create objects in Revit.
  • Handle responses and errors from Revit.
  • Manage server startup and shutdown lifecycle.

Installation

Prerequisites

  • xml.Revit 1.3.4.3 or newer
  • Python 3.10 or newer
  • uv package manager:

On Windows install uv as

pip install uv

Otherwise installation instructions are on their website: Install uv

⚠️ Do not proceed before installing UV

pip install revit-mcp

if intallation fails, try to install uv first

test the installation by running the command line interface of Revit MCP.

uvx revit-mcp

RevitMCPServer - INFO - Successfully connected to Revit on startup

Now you can use Revit MCP in your LLM .

Claude for Desktop Integration

Watch the setup instruction video (Assuming you have already installed uv)

Go to Claude > Settings > Developer > Edit Config.

edit claude_desktop_config.json

to include the following:

{
    "mcpServers": {
        "RevitMCPServer": {
            "command": "uvx",
            "args": [
                "revit-mcp"
            ]
        }
    }
}
